Renewable Energy Engineer (35%): As the UK strives to meet its ambitious renewable energy targets, the demand for skilled renewable energy engineers is on the rise. These professionals design, develop, and implement sustainable energy systems ranging from wind and solar power to hydroelectric and geothermal technologies. Sustainability Consultant (25%): In the UK's rapidly evolving green economy, sustainability consultants are indispensable to businesses and organisations looking to optimise their environmental impact. They provide strategic guidance on energy efficiency, sustainable resource management, and waste reduction. Energy Efficiency Analyst (20%): With the UK government's commitment to reducing greenhouse gas emissions, energy efficiency analysts play a vital role in identifying opportunities for businesses and individuals to conserve energy and lower their carbon footprint. They analyse energy data, develop energy-saving strategies, and monitor progress towards sustainability goals. Carbon Reduction Manager (15%): Driven by the UK's ambitious climate targets, carbon reduction managers are critical to the country's path towards a low-carbon economy. They develop, implement, and oversee carbon reduction strategies for businesses, public institutions, and non-profit organisations, ensuring compliance with legal and regulatory requirements while maximising sustainability and cost savings. Zero Waste Coordinator (5%): The UK's commitment to a circular economy has created a significant demand for zero waste coordinators. They lead waste reduction and recycling initiatives, helping businesses and communities transition towards a more sustainable and eco-friendly future.
